¿Cuánto cuesta alquilar un apartamento en Naperville?
| Dormitorios | Precio Promedio | Más barato | Más caro |
|---|---|---|---|
| Townhomes en Alquiler 2 Dormitorios en 60564 | $2,561 | $2,250 | $3,200 |
| Townhomes en Alquiler 3 Dormitorios en 60564 | $3,113 | $2,910 | $3,400 |
